Transaction 63b7bf5b7fb2912e0a311f6974cff0e2138a4bf2cab6fd222a3d5bf0a5b13994

1 Input
2 Outputs
  • 63b7bf5b7fb2912e0a311f6974cff0e2138a4bf2cab6fd222a3d5bf0a5b13994:0
  • value  12359666
    address  39Xow5Haba6qWTozhFBdid29dw95reTqbK
  • 63b7bf5b7fb2912e0a311f6974cff0e2138a4bf2cab6fd222a3d5bf0a5b13994:1
  • value  1620000
    address  3FyLHyJEKphyMxwFVDF5xw6AgFFJeKmHM2